Ward Clerk Position (Children's Ward)

20 Hours per week - Mon & Tues 8-3:30pm & Wed 8-2pm

An opportunity has arisen for an experienced, motivated, enthusiastic and flexible individual to join our busy ward clerk team working as a Ward Clerk on our busy children's ward. The hours of work are as stated above.

You will mainly play a key role in the day to day running of a busy ward ensuring that the administration of the patients is completed in a timely manner. You will be expected to carry out a wide range of clerical and administrative duties. Previous administration experience essential, as is computer literacy and customer service skills.

You must be able to work with discretion and maintain confidentiality at all times. You will be well organised and able to use your own initiative in a demanding environment, have the ability to work under pressure and be flexible. You should poss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, and have an good understanding of Patient Administration systems but not essential as training will be given.

Assist in the welcome and reception of patients and visitors into the clinical area, maintaining a courteous and professional manner at all times.

Handle telephone calls and face to face enquiries from relatives, hospital staff and members of the Public in a constructive and sympathetic manner referring to the appropriate person where necessary.

Use computer skills and other clerical activity to perform the correct procedure for admission, discharge, transfer and death of patients and make arrangements for follow up appointments in the manner laid down by the Trust.

To be responsible for any information entered onto the computer whilst carrying out the duties required by the Trust, and maintaining confidentiality.

Report any errors, duplications or omissions in patient information to the appropriate department and carry out the correct procedure to rectify the problem as per Trust policy.

Ensure that patients’ medical records are available on the ward, obtaining these where necessary from other departments according to Trust policy. Ensuring notes are traced to the correct location.

Ensure patient confidentiality/privacy is maintained at all times in accordance with Trust policy.
